Technically,
asphalt can be defined as both the natural rock that is found in various parts
of the world and the by-product of crude petroleum. Asphalt is used in a
variety of construction purpose owing to the durability of the product. It also
allows heavy transport to pass on without cracking under pressure. It is one of
the reasons why civil construction engineers use asphalt as the main product in
the construction of roads. With time as civilization is growing, there is a definite
rise in asphalt sales. The high-quality asphalt is also
put to many other uses apart from the road construction.

Road
construction: since asphalt is highly resistant
to weather, waterproof, has a tremendous binding capacity and can provide
flexibility on the surface in terms of inclination, it is used in road
construction. When you get deep into the study of asphalt for road
construction, you will come across three types of asphalt that is used for the
purpose:
- Rolled asphalt
- Mastic asphalt
- Compressed rock asphalt
Each
of the mentioned types has a variety of uses and cannot be replaced for one
another. The essential quality of each one of them remains the same. For
example, the rolled asphalt is only used in the making of the pavements along
the roads.
Asphalt
paints: if the construction engineer has put
concrete or damp walls in the construction of the building, then the asphaltic
colors can come in handy for the upkeep of the building life. However, it is
the bituminous asphalt that is used in the paints in such areas. It prevents
the dampness from spoiling the interior decoration of the place.
Asphalt
concrete: We have already discussed that
asphalt has excellent binding properties that have led to the rise in asphalt
sales. The asphalt concrete is mixed with fine, coarse aggregates to give the
desired product that has excellent resistance to weight and moving vehicles. It
is mostly used in the highway areas as well as the runway for airplanes. Along
with the strength of the asphalt, it also allows the desired level of
flexibility in the track and the highway that can help the vehicle steer in the
direction of its choice.
